‘Guitar Hero: Van Halen’ Confirmed

eddie van halen 5 Guitar Hero: Van Halen Confirmed“Let’s get ready to rock!!!” Don’t you ever undermine this statement because in this you’ll be rocking all night long – that’s only if you can keep you fingers from melting off.

According to has confirmed to them that Guitar Hero: is indeed in development and will release sometime during the second half of this year.

Activision could not confirm any songs, and only said the game will contain Van Halen’s “,” as well as guest acts such as Queen, , Blink-182, The Offspring, Queens of the Stone Age, and more.

However, they were told by Activision’s Senior of Global Brand Management that, “… this is definitely Van Halen, not Van Hagar,” which is a plus since is back with the band and they just finished a successful tour.

In addition, they revealed that there’s a very slim chance that the rockers might show up at E3 2009.
